Scientific Name:
Tradescantia pallida
Pronunciation:
trad-ess-KANT-ee-uh PAL-ih-duh
Common Name:
wandering Jew , spiderwort
Family Name:
Commelinaceae
Plant Type:
Annual, Flowering pot plant
Key ID Features:
Stems thick but fragile; leaves pointed, lanceolate-oblong to oblong-elliptic, bases sheathing the stem, to 15cm long; flowers with 3 pink petals, about 2cm wide, in small clusters.
